Very large bright white head of fine bubbles. Recedes slowly. Light lemon, rice cereal and some straw. Cloudy bright gold in color. Light lemon and grassy notes agin. Refreshing. An ok belgian wit. Fits the bill and hits the marks but nothing to brag about.
